Come to Caledon State Park on the longest day of the year to celebrate the changing of the seasons and look for the first signs of the summer.

The hike will be about three and a half miles along some of our earthen-path trails, such as Fern Hollow, Poplar Grove, Laurel Glen, and Benchmark. Come dressed for the weather, wear good hiking/walking shoes, and bring water.

This program is free, but give us a call or stop by the Visitor Center to let us know you are coming. Parking fee is $5.
